Netflix and Premio Solinas launch fourth edition of screenwriting workshop in Rome
In Rome, the fourth iteration of La Bottega della Sceneggiatura, a screenwriting initiative by Premio Solinas in collaboration with Netflix, has commenced. This program is designed for young screenwriters aged 18 to 30 living in Italy, with a strong emphasis on diversity and inclusion. Interested applicants can submit their entries until October 20, 2025. A panel of industry experts will choose up to 20 projects for the Orientation Laboratory, where concepts will be developed further. From there, ten projects will move on to the Advanced Training Laboratory, each receiving a scholarship of €2,500. Additionally, two projects will be awarded €7,000 and €4,000, respectively. Netflix may also provide winners with opportunities as writing room assistants for an original series, reinforcing their dedication to fostering emerging Italian talent.
